The most common manner of liquid chromatography is reversed section, whereby the cell phases used, involve any miscible mix of drinking water or buffers with a variety of natural and organic solvents (the most typical are acetonitrile and methanol). Some HPLC tactics use h2o-absolutely free cell phases (see usual-section chromatography down below). The aqueous component on the cellular stage may well consist of acids (like formic, phosphoric or trifluoroacetic acid) or salts to aid from the separation in the sample components. The composition with the mobile section may very well be saved constant ("isocratic elution method") or varied ("gradient elution mode") in the chromatographic Assessment. Isocratic elution is typically productive during the separation of simple mixtures. Gradient elution is necessary for intricate mixtures, with varying interactions While using the stationary and cellular phases.

HPLC analysis assists assure foods and beverages are unadulterated and freed from unsafe toxins and carcinogens by detecting residual pesticides and verifying the purity and authenticity of components.

One among the most important industrial people of ion Trade is the food stuff and beverage sector to determine the nitrogen-, sulfur-, and phosphorous- made up of species together with the halide ions. Also, ion Trade can be utilized to ascertain the dissolved inorganic and natural and organic ions in all-natural and dealt with waters.
